What is the return policy for JanSport backpacks? ›JanSport Return Policy
If you're unsatisfied for any reason, simply return your merchandise within 60 days of purchase, provided it has not been damaged, altered or used. Final Clearance items are not eligible for returns.

How does lifetime warranty work? ›A lifetime warranty is a guarantee that a manufacturer will repair or replace any defective parts for their products and comes at no additional cost. The “lifetime” may reference the suggested lifetime of the product (when used as intended), or the time that the product is in production (or some years after that date).
How long do you have to claim a warranty? ›Generally, customers have four years to enforce an implied warranty claim. Merchants of used goods also give implied warranties. You can sell without implied warranties—"as is"—in most, but not all states.

Can zippers be replaced on backpacks? ›
The first step in replacing your backpack zipper is to measure the length of the existing zipper. This is the length required for your new zipper. I suggest buying a zipper which looks the same strength, for example this backpack zipper has metal teeth so I ensured I bought a metal teeth zipper as the replacement.
Can backpacks be repaired? ›A tear is no reason to give up on your beloved backpack! All backpacks can be patched and stitched as needed, including torn bottoms and corners. Cobblers can also repair damaged inside lining or replace it altogether, if necessary.
When did JanSport stop being made in USA? ›JanSport started by developing the external frame backpack which used a metal frame with a cloth packsack attached to it. The products made include technical day packs and internal frame backpacks. Up until the early 1990s all JanSport packs were made in the United States.
